Job Description Company Overview FreeCast is solving the problem of multiple streaming service providers offering different content and delivery models by gathering it all into one aggregate platform for consumers. Our SmartGuide® technology collects, consolidates, and arranges live linear channels, streaming programs, and movies—whether free, pay-per-view, or subscription-based—into a single interface.
